I came to Samcha after a recommendation from a friend, I was told it was extremely spicy & delicious, so I came with expectations. It was great, the food was piping hot & fresh, & the flavors were amazing. (I had the kimchi fried rice, extremely creamy & savory with that signature gochujang flavor). Along with that, I also had the spicy teokbokki with cheese that was equally delicious. Now, as to the reason why I only rated it 4*, the teokbokki was perfectly spicy, but the kimchi fried rice barely had any spice. According to my friend, it tasted as though they've toned down the spice quite a lot since her last visit. She had the spicy udon, & there was the same statement in terms of spice level. I have a pretty low spice tolerance, & when I can barely taste it, something feels wrong. I'd recommend asking to make it spicier if you're planning to order something spicy. Other than that, it's a great place with an amazingly warm & bustling atmosphere! The sojus tastes great.
